Output de830e08ea88cf4f95e9562226d7ff23fd64eea0f4fa63c765e3c6f7e8f2f90e:1

value
1330104
script pubkey
OP_0 OP_PUSHBYTES_20 80c8580602c9808c9b1a31172a184c0ccc62678e
address
bc1qsry9spszexqgexc6xytj5xzvpnxxyeuwfjc2fa
transaction
de830e08ea88cf4f95e9562226d7ff23fd64eea0f4fa63c765e3c6f7e8f2f90e
confirmations
2988
spent
true